Warning Signs Your Commercial HVAC Needs Attention

Escalating Energy Bills

You're reviewing utility statements and seeing a noticeable and consistent increase in your monthly energy expenditures, even without a significant change in your business operations or external temperatures. This often points to an HVAC system operating inefficiently. Components like dirty coils, failing motors, or a low refrigerant charge force the system to work harder to maintain set temperatures, consuming more power than necessary. Unchecked inefficiency directly erodes your business's profitability, a critical concern for Roseland businesses managing operational costs. Continued operation under these conditions can also accelerate wear and tear on major components, leading to premature failure and much more expensive repairs or replacement down the line.

Inconsistent Temperatures Across Your Property

Employees or clients in certain areas of your Roseland office or retail space are constantly complaining about being too hot or too cold, while other areas feel perfectly comfortable. You might notice some vents blowing stronger than others, or no air at all. This usually indicates issues with zoning, ductwork integrity, or airflow. Leaky or blocked ducts, malfunctioning zone dampers, or an improperly sized system can prevent conditioned air from reaching all areas evenly, which is a common problem in commercial buildings with various internal spaces. Beyond the obvious discomfort and productivity dip, inconsistent temperatures can lead to overworking the system in an attempt to compensate, further increasing energy consumption and potentially shortening the lifespan of your commercial HVAC unit.

Unusual Noises or Odors

Your commercial HVAC units, whether rooftop or internal, are emitting strange sounds like grinding, squealing, rattling, or thumping. You might also detect musty, burning, or electrical odors emanating from the vents. Grinding or squealing often signals worn bearings or belts. Rattling can indicate loose components or debris. Musty smells point to mold or mildew in the ductwork or evaporator coil, a particular concern with Roseland's summer humidity. Burning or electrical odors are serious warning signs of overheating components or electrical issues. These are often precursors to major mechanical failure, which can be particularly disruptive and unprofessional in quiet office or retail environments. Ignoring them can lead to costly breakdowns, fire hazards (especially with electrical smells), or significant indoor air quality issues that affect employee health and comfort.

Frequent Cycling or Constant Running

Your commercial heating or cooling system is turning on and off much more frequently than usual (short cycling), or it seems to run almost continuously without ever reaching the desired temperature. Short cycling can be caused by an oversized system, a faulty thermostat, or a clogged filter restricting airflow. Constant running often points to an undersized unit struggling to meet demand, a low refrigerant charge in AC systems, or significant air leaks in the building envelope. Both scenarios lead to excessive energy waste and accelerated wear on the compressor and other critical components. This shortens the system's lifespan and can result in premature, expensive replacement.

What's Causing Your Commercial HVAC Problems

Lack of Regular Commercial HVAC Maintenance

Many Roseland businesses, focused on daily operations, overlook the critical importance of routine preventive maintenance. Filters become clogged, coils accumulate dirt, and moving parts wear down without lubrication or adjustment. The demanding climate of Roseland, with its hot, humid summers and cold winters, puts immense strain on HVAC systems. Without annual tune-ups, this constant stress leads to accelerated wear and tear, making systems far more susceptible to breakdowns. A comprehensive commercial HVAC maintenance plan, including inspection, cleaning, lubrication, and calibration of all components, is essential to ensure efficiency and longevity.

Aging Equipment and Infrastructure

Older commercial HVAC systems, particularly those installed in established Roseland properties from decades past, simply reach the end of their operational lifespan. Components like compressors, heat exchangers, and motors degrade over time, losing efficiency and becoming prone to failure. Roseland has many well-established commercial properties. While well-maintained, their original HVAC installations may be 15-20+ years old, utilizing outdated technology that is less efficient and more difficult to repair with readily available parts. While repairs can sometimes extend life, persistent issues and high energy consumption often signal that commercial HVAC installation & replacement is the most cost-effective long-term solution, upgrading to a modern, energy-efficient system.

Ductwork Leaks and Poor Insulation

Over time, commercial ductwork can develop leaks at seams and connections due to shifting building structures, poor initial installation, or pest damage. Inadequate insulation around ducts, particularly in unconditioned spaces like attics or basements, leads to significant thermal loss. The significant temperature differential between conditioned indoor air and unconditioned outdoor or attic spaces during Roseland's extreme seasons exacerbates energy loss through leaky or poorly insulated ducts. This makes businesses pay to condition air that never reaches its intended destination. A thorough inspection of the entire ductwork system, sealing any leaks with mastic or specialized tape, and upgrading insulation where necessary is crucial to prevent energy waste and ensure even air distribution.

Refrigerant Leaks (for AC-based systems)

Refrigerant is the lifeblood of an air conditioning system. Leaks can develop in coils, lines, or connections due to cracks, corrosion, or vibration. When refrigerant levels drop, the system cannot effectively absorb and release heat. The intense, prolonged heat and humidity of Roseland summers place immense strain on commercial AC units. This sustained operation and thermal cycling can contribute to material fatigue, leading to the development of small leaks over time. The solution involves identifying and repairing the leak, followed by recharging the system with the correct amount and type of refrigerant. Simply adding refrigerant without fixing the leak is a temporary and costly solution.
